New Opportunities for Connectivity
The launch of 3GPP Non-Terrestrial Networks (NTNs) means satellites are now part of the cellular world. This development allows devices to connect beyond traditional cell towers. As a result, people can get signals in rural, remote, or even oceanic areas. This makes mobile access more universal and reliable. Because of this, fewer places remain offline, opening new possibilities for everyday communication.

Improving Lives and the Future of Connectivity
For people worldwide, this means better safety and smarter services. Emergency responders can use satellite networks when local signals fail. Travelers, explorers, and those in disaster zones can stay connected easier. Over time, this new approach can lead to improved health, safety, and economic opportunities. Overall, integrating satellites into everyday devices promises a more connected and resilient world.
